Hajarpur is a Rural village located in Maker, Saran, Bihar.

The total population of Hajarpur is 2,072.

Hajarpur village comprises 385 households.

The literacy rate in Hajarpur is 62.2%. Among the literate population of 1,066, there are 598 literate males and 468 literate females.

In Hajarpur, there are 1,047 males and 1,025 females, with a sex ratio of 979 females per 1000 males.

There are 358 children (17.3% of population), comprising 213 boys and 145 girls.

The total number of workers in Hajarpur is 831, with 352 main workers and 479 marginal workers.

In Hajarpur, there are 529 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(263 males, 266 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Hajarpur is located in Bihar state, Saran district, and falls under Maker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 233995 and LGD code is 233995.
